The video discusses the rebellion in Budapest, highlighting the Hungarian capital's fight for freedom and the potential collapse of the Kremlin's influence. It emphasizes Poland's pivotal role, with Wladyslaw Komolka emerging as a key figure in the shift towards independence from Moscow. The narrative covers the disintegration of the Iron Curtain and the growing calls for Russian withdrawal. Monsignor Béla Várga's speech underscores the Hungarian people's determination for liberty, with a hopeful outlook on the eventual achievement of freedom, despite the sacrifices involved.
